I am a sculptor who likes to take clay to the limits of its own structural integrity, creating complex forms without supporting armatures, building instinctually on an idea and allowing it to find its own balance, physical and conceptual. I am a largely self-taught artist who loves to experiment and embrace the unexpected.
Where do you find inspiration?Everywhere. But firstly within my own struggles to make sense of the world around me. I think of archetypes and who we are in relation to who society, history and culture, shape us and then categorize us to be. I search for beauty and meaning in those contrasts and I often explore the intersections of classical art, ceramics tradition of functionality, and abstraction, condensing those thoughts into form.
